Kohima
Kohima is a music video for an original song written and performed by pop tenor Saahil Bhargava. The heart-wrenching, edgy ballad focuses on the trauma of soldiers at war. Using the backdrop of the Battle of Kohima from World War 2, the story rock music video employs rotoscope animation to explore the despair and desperation that come in the heat of a brutal battle.

Saahil Bhargava is originally from New York but has lived in London and Mumbai before calling Los Angeles home.
After performing in front of a crowd as a young boy, he was hooked and knew he would pursue music.
Saahil enjoys telling stories and exploring interesting concepts and emotions. All of his songs tend to be stories about characters going through emotional experiences or intense moments.
He is musically influenced by a range of artists such as Freddie Mercury, Bono, Chester Bennington and Chris Cornell to Radiohead, Muse, Keane and My Chemical Romance.
Saahil is founder and creative lead of Raijin Entertainment and Kinsane Entertainment.
From RadioandMusic.com April 19, 2021 interview:
Talking about the song, Saahil says, “I just thought it was an interesting perspective to the narrative of war that we’ve all grown up with. I imagined a soldier who was not driven by winning the war or bringing glory to his people - he just wanted to survive. And that is what the core of this song is all about. This soldier’s desire to get back home, somehow.”
